Altoona Fraternity Suspended After Hazing Allegedly Contributes to Suicide

An unnamed Penn State Altoona fraternity is under suspension after one its members committed suicide over spring break, and an internal campus investigation is looking into claims from his family that hazing contributed to the tragedy.

After Condom Spat, UPUA Approves Funding for Sexual Violence Prevention & Awareness Month

With two meetings to go and over $115,000 left to spend, it took a bit of squabbling, but the University Park Undergraduate Association approved, among three other resolutions, a bill giving funding to Sexual Violence Prevention & Awareness Month, which will take place in April.

Two Penn State Rugby Players Charged With Burning Down a Shed

Two Penn State rugby players have been charged with setting their own team's shed on fire, according to the Penn State Police log, as first reported by the Centre Daily Times.
